Recipe Box
Deborah Szmodis’s wooden recipe card box, decorated with strawberries, contains part of her complete recipe card collection. Created by Woodcrest by Styson, it is part of a larger matching kitchen storage collection from around the 1960s.
Recipe Cards
The recipe cards below reflect just a sampling of the family's complete card collection and focus on desserts like cakes, pies, and Christmas cookies. As you can see, some recipes are typed or handwritten on index cards, while others are recorded on pieces of scrap paper.

Abbreviations Glossary:
Each recipe is also accompanied with a transcription of the text. Here is a glossary of some common abbreviations you’ll see used in the recipes.
t. = teaspoon
T. = tablespoon
c. = cup
b. sugar = brown sugar
b. soda = baking soda
b. powder = baking powder
van. = vanilla
cin. = cinnamon
